Vedanta Aluminium purchases 354 mln units of renewable energy for FY 2022

August 03, 2021 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

Indian producer Vedanta Aluminium has purchased 354 million units of renewable energy for the 2022 financial year, it announced on Monday August 2.

The energy, which will be from a mix of solar and non-solar renewable sources, will be used to help power aluminium production at its Jharsugada smelter in Odisha, India, to help the company achieve its carbon mitigation goals while producing "green," value-added products, it said.Vedanta purchased the renewable energy units through the Indian Energy Exchange (IEX)...
